SALT LAKE CITY, Utah – Every once in a while, despite the chaos and uncertainty that has encapsulated the world as of late, a video pops up on social media that brings light back to the world.
This time, Aaron Herrera, Justen Glad and Tate Schmitt are seen juggling a roll of toilet paper between the three of them before Herrera volleys the roll into a miniature indoor basketball net.

On March 12 Major League Soccer, along with seemingly every other professional sporting organization, announced that they will suspend their season indefinitely for at least 30 days.
Prior to the suspension, RSL had accumulated two points from two games. They drew 0-0 against Orlando City and 1-1 against the New York Red Bulls for their home opener.
